上颌骨扩张对一名残奥运动员呼吸功能和运动表现的影响——病例报告。

Effects of maxillary skeletal expansion on respiratory function and sport performance in a para-athlete - A case report.

机构信息

Department of Microbiology, Sao Leopoldo Mandic Institute and Research Center, SP, Brazil.

Department of Post-graduation in Orthodontics, Sao Leopoldo Mandic Institute and Research Center, Campinas, SP, Brazil.

出版信息

Phys Ther Sport. 2019 Mar;36:70-77. doi: 10.1016/j.ptsp.2019.01.005. Epub 2019 Jan 14.

DOI:10.1016/j.ptsp.2019.01.005
PMID:30677598
Abstract

The aim of this case report was to demonstrate the effects of the Maxillary Skeletal Expander (MSE) used to orthopedically correct a maxillary constriction, on the respiratory functions and swimming performance of a Para-athlete. Cone-beam computed tomography (CBCT) images taken before and after MSE activation were used to demonstrate the disarticulation of midpalatal suture, and the changes involved in dental and nasomaxillary structures, nasal cavity and pharyngeal airway. Respiratory tests included: maximum inspiratory and expiratory pressure, oral peak expiratory flow and inspiratory nasal flow. The 6-min-walk and heart rate recovery tests were also performed. Patient's swimming performances during national swimming competitions were compared. CBCT images showed that palatal expansion was 5.91  mm at the suture, and that nasal and pharyngeal airways increased in volume by 31%. All respiratory indices improved after MSE activation. The 6-min walk test and heart rate recovery test performance also improved after the maxillary expansion. Patient's swimming performance in all category were anemic prior to the treatment, but performance improved considerably after the expansion, particularly the 100 m-Backstroke modality. MSE treatment had a significant positive impact in respiratory functions and sport performance.

摘要

本病例报告旨在展示上颌骨扩张器(MSE)在矫治安氏Ⅱ类 1 分类错颌中的作用,及其对上颌后缩患者呼吸功能和游泳表现的影响。通过对 MSE 激活前后的锥形束 CT(CBCT)图像进行分析,展示了中隔骨缝的分离,以及牙和鼻上颌结构、鼻腔和咽气道的变化。呼吸测试包括:最大吸气和呼气压力、口腔呼气峰流速和鼻吸气流量。还进行了 6 分钟步行和心率恢复测试。比较了患者在全国游泳比赛中的游泳表现。CBCT 图像显示,骨缝处腭扩张 5.91  mm,鼻和咽气道体积增加 31%。MSE 激活后,所有呼吸指标均得到改善。上颌骨扩张后,6 分钟步行测试和心率恢复测试的表现也得到了改善。患者在接受治疗前所有泳姿的成绩都较差,但在扩张后成绩有了显著提高,特别是 100 米仰泳。MSE 治疗对上颌后缩患者的呼吸功能和运动表现有显著的积极影响。
